Output 1ec92fa8869ffd593eb64022b96de8d18a9246717964e8fdfd4210145de0f8af:50

value
1040371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33c61cd4cd9df8c8dc61e3ca47eabb89af4bead OP_EQUAL
address
3NQXeWMNKLfuxiwYWEeEnvYVtV2gr5UGQ7
transaction
1ec92fa8869ffd593eb64022b96de8d18a9246717964e8fdfd4210145de0f8af
confirmations
239460
spent
true